Wynnewood, Oklahoma, offers a variety of outdoor activities and natural attractions that are perfect for families and individuals seeking fun and relaxation. One of the most notable spots is the nearby Turner Falls Park, located about 30 minutes away. This park features stunning waterfalls, hiking trails, and swimming areas that provide a great opportunity for picnicking and enjoying nature. The picturesque scenery makes it an ideal spot for photography and outdoor exploration.

In town, the Wynnewood City Park is a family-friendly area that features playgrounds, picnic tables, and open spaces for recreational activities. It’s a great place for children to play and for families to gather for an afternoon of fun. The park’s walking paths are also perfect for a leisurely stroll or a brisk walk, allowing visitors to enjoy the fresh air and local wildlife.

For those interested in history, the nearby Chickasaw Cultural Center, located about 40 minutes from Wynnewood, offers educational exhibits and programs that highlight the history and culture of the Chickasaw Nation. This center provides interactive experiences that make learning engaging for visitors of all ages and is a great way to spend a day while gaining insight into the region’s heritage.

If you enjoy fishing or want to introduce your children to the sport, the Washita River runs nearby and offers various spots for fishing. The riverbanks provide a peaceful atmosphere where families can spend quality time together, casting lines and enjoying the tranquility of the water.

When the weather isn’t ideal for outdoor activities, families can visit local community centers or libraries, which often have programs and activities for children. These venues provide a cozy environment for reading or participating in arts and crafts, making them perfect for a rainy day.

For those who enjoy hiking, the Arbuckle Mountains are within an hour’s drive from Wynnewood and offer numerous trails that range in difficulty. The trails are surrounded by beautiful landscapes and diverse wildlife, making it a great destination for outdoor enthusiasts. Hiking in this area allows you to appreciate Oklahoma’s natural beauty while getting some exercise.
